Testimony on Understanding the Implications and Consequences of the Proposed Rule on Risk Retention

Chairman Garrett, Ranking Member Waters, and members of the Subcommittee: April 14. 2011---My name is Meredith Cross, and I am the Director of the Division of Corporation Finance at the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ission. I am pleased to testify on behalf of the Commission today on the topic of risk retention in securitizations. I appreciate the opportunity to discuss with you the Commission’s work in this area.

Background
Securitization generally is a financing technique in which financial assets, in many cases illiquid, are pooled and converted into instruments that are offered and sold in the capital markets as securities. The securities sold through these types of vehicles are called asset-backed securities, or ABS. This financing technique makes it easier for lenders to exchange payment streams coming from the loans for cash. Some of the types of assets that are financed through securitization include residential and commercial mortgages, agricultural equipment leases, automobile loans and leases, student loans and credit card receivables. Often, a bundle of loans is divided into separate securities with different levels of risks and returns. Payments on the loans typically are distributed to the holders of the lower-risk, lower-interest securities first, and then to the holders of the higher-risk securities.

The financial crisis focused attention on the possible misalignment of incentives of participants in the securitization process. Risk retention requirements have been discussed by some market participants as one potential way to improve the quality of asset-backed securities by better aligning the incentives of the sponsors and originators of the pool assets with investors’ incentives.

iShares Publishes Educational Materials on ETF Tax Efficiency

April 14, 2011--BlackRock, Inc. (NYSE: BLK) today announced that its iShares® Exchange Traded Funds (ETFs) business, the world's largest manager of ETFs, has published a fact sheet on tax efficiency and created a video to drive awareness among U.S. investors about ETFs' tax efficiency as the U.S. tax filing deadline approaches. Today, there are over 1,000 different ETFs available and iShares is emphasizing tax efficiency during the current tax season to foster understanding and to encourage investors to take a careful examination of products with tax consequences in mind.

In April, investors should be keenly aware of the tax ramifications on their investments, some of which may cause a drag on performance and produce an obstacle to realizing their identified financial goals. To compound the issue, many investment strategists believe we are now in a lower return market environment, where the impact of taxes on a portfolio may be further magnified.

ProShares Launches First ETFs Providing Magnified Exposure to the High Yield and Investment Grade Corporate Bond Markets

April 14, 2011--ProShares, a premier provider of alternative exchange traded funds (ETFs), today announced the launch of the first ETFs that provide magnified exposure to the high yield and investment grade corporate bond markets.
ProShares Ultra High Yield (NYSE: UJB) seeks to provide 2x the daily performance of the Markit iBoxx® $ Liquid High Yield Index, before fees and expenses.

ProShares Ultra Investment Grade Corporate (NYSE: IGU) seeks to provide 2x the daily performance of the Markit iBoxx® $ Liquid Investment Grade Index, before fees and expenses. Both ETFs list on NYSE Arca today.

On the heels of launching the first inverse ETFs on the high yield and investment grade corporate bond markets, we are pleased to offer the first leveraged ETFs on these segments of the fixed income landscape," said Michael L. Sapir, Chairman and CEO of ProShare Advisors LLC, ProShares' investment advisor. "With today's launch, knowledgeable investors now have an even larger suite of geared ETFs to help manage their exposures to high yield and investment grade corporate bonds."

Morningstar Reports U.S. Mutual Fund and ETF Asset Flows Through March 2011

April 13, 2011—Morningstar, Inc. a leading provider of independent investment research, today reported estimated U.S. mutual fund and exchange-traded fund asset flows through March 2011. The pace of inflows into long-term mutual funds slowed slightly to $27.0 billion in March from approximately $27.9 billion in February, due largely to a reversal in U.S. stock flows. The asset class saw outflows of $934 million in March after taking in roughly $26.1 billion combined in January and February. Inflows for U.S. ETFs rose to $7.4 billion in March after reaching $6.6 billion in February despite outflows of $3.3 billion from U.S. stock ETFs, which typically drive industry inflows.

Diversified emerging-markets flows, which have attracted a significant amount of attention since the financial crisis began in late 2008, highlight a striking difference in the way American and European investors express their appetite for emerging-markets exposure. European investors have a much greater proportion of their money in emerging markets than American investors and more funds to choose from to gain emerging-markets exposure. But Americans have been adding aggressively to emerging-markets funds in recent years, and are increasingly choosing to invest in them through passively managed products. Six years ago, actively managed open-end mutual funds and ETFs comprised 79% of diversified emerging-markets assets, but today make up 53%.

Global X Funds Launches Waste Management ETF (WSTE)

April 13, 2011 – Global X Funds, the New York based provider of exchange traded funds (ETFs), today launched the Global X Waste Management ETF (Ticker: WSTE). WSTE is approximately evenly divided among the disposal of hazardous waste, non-hazardous waste and recycling sectors.

The world’s population growth and burgeoning middle class is creating a steady rise in demand for energy and consumer products, with an ever-increasing need for sanitation and waste-disposal services. The proper disposal of hazardous and non-hazardous waste is a critical and growing aspect of many industries, especially as corporations are held more accountable for the waste they produce. Investors in WSTE may stand to benefit from mandatory safety standards and environmental regulations imposed on these companies, which enforce the removal of pesticides, petrochemicals, nuclear, and industrial waste. In addition, the process of recycling is critical for managing available resources and controlling the costs of basic materials. If the world’s appetite for raw materials continues to grow, recycling may stand to become increasingly cost effective and a more viable substitute for primary production.

“The Waste Management ETF (WSTE) provides relatively easy access to a global industry that continues to grow rapidly as the world’s population and individual incomes expand along with the need to manage waste and recycle resources,” said Global X Funds CEO Bruno del Ama.

The Global X Waste Management ETF tracks the Solactive Global Waste Management Index, which tracks the price movements in shares of companies which are active in the hazardous waste, non-hazardous waste and recycling industries. As of April 7, 2011, the three largest components of the index were Stericycle Inc., Waste Management Inc., and Veolia Environnement SA.

Goldman criticised in US Senate report

April 13, 2011--US Senate investigators probing the financial crisis will refer evidence about Wall Street institutions including Goldman Sachs and Deutsche Bank to the justice department for possible criminal investigations, officials said on Wednesday.

Carl Levin, Democratic chairman of the powerful Senate permanent subcommittee on investigations, said a two-year probe found that banks mis-sold mortgage-backed securities and misled investors and lawmakers.
